跳至內容

typescript 如何打包

更新時間
快连VPN:速度和安全性最佳的VPN服务
快连VPN:速度和安全性最佳的VPN服务
打包 typescript 代码是将其转换为可分发的应用程序或库的过程。最常用的方法是使用构建工具,如 webpack 或 rollup。使用 webpack 打包 typescript 代码的步骤:安装 webpack 和 typescript。创建配置文件 webpack.config.js。编写 typescript 代码。在 webpack.config.js 中使用 ts-loader 插件导入 typescript。运行 webpack 命令或使用 webpack cli 构建应用程

如何打包 TypeScript 代码

打包 TypeScript 代码是将源代码转换为可分发和可执行的应用程序或库的过程。有几种流行的方法可以打包 TypeScript 代码,最常见的方法是使用构建工具,例如 Webpack 或 Rollup。

使用 Webpack

Webpack 是一个现代的模块打包器,广泛用于打包 JavaScript 和 TypeScript 代码。它允许您定义模块依赖项、加载器和插件,并生成优化的捆绑包。要使用 Webpack 打包 TypeScript 代码,请按照以下步骤操作:

  1. 安装 Webpack 和 TypeScript:使用 npm 安装 webpack 和 typescript。
  2. 创建配置文件:创建 webpack.config.js 文件并配置您的构建设置。
  3. 编写 TypeScript 代码:在单独的文件中编写您的 TypeScript 代码。
  4. 导入 TypeScript:在 webpack.config.js 中,使用 ts-loader 插件加载 TypeScript 文件。
  5. 构建应用程序:运行 webpack 命令或使用 Webpack CLI 构建您的应用程序。

使用 Rollup

Rollup 是另一个流行的模块打包器,以其构建速度快和打包体积小而闻名。它最适合打包较小的应用程序和库。要使用 Rollup 打包 TypeScript 代码,请按照以下步骤操作:

  1. 安装 Rollup 和 TypeScript:使用 npm 安装 rollup 和 @rollup/plugin-typescript。
  2. 创建配置文件:创建 rollup.config.js 文件并配置您的构建设置。
  3. 编写 TypeScript 代码:在单独的文件中编写您的 TypeScript 代码。
  4. 导入 TypeScript:在 rollup.config.js 中,使用 @rollup/plugin-typescript 插件加载 TypeScript 文件。
  5. 构建应用程序:运行 rollup 命令或使用 Rollup CLI 构建您的应用程序。

其他打包选项

除了 Webpack 和 Rollup 之外,还有一些其他可以用来打包 TypeScript 代码的工具,包括:

  • Parcel:一个零配置构建工具,适用于小型项目。
  • Terser:一个用于压缩和混淆 JavaScript 的工具,可以与 TypeScript 一起使用。
  • Babel:一个 JavaScript 编译器,可以将 TypeScript 转换为 ES5 或 ES6 代码。

选择哪个打包工具取决于您的特定需求和偏好。建议探索每个工具并尝试确定最适合您项目的工具。

以上就是typescript 如何打包的详细内容,更多请关注本站其它相关文章!

更新時間

發表留言

請注意,留言須先通過審核才能發佈。